#ca3637 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ca3637 is composed of 79.2% red, 21.2%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.3% magenta, 72.8%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 359.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 50.2%. #ca3637 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6c6e with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#ca3637

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f0f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ca3637

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867a7a is the less saturated color, while #fb0507 is the most saturated one.
